Google Ads can cost between $100 and $10,000 per month, but the exact price depends on several factors:
- Cost per click (CPC) or cost per 1,000 impressions (CPM): On average, businesses pay $0.11–$0.50 per click and $0.51–$1,000 per 1,000 impressions
- Industry: The industry you're in can significantly impact your pricing
- Campaign strategy and ad types: The types of ads you use and your campaign strategy can affect your pricing
- Bidding approach: Your bidding approach can impact your pricing
- Ad scheduling: When you schedule your ads can impact your pricing
- Device targeting: Which devices you target can impact your pricing
- Shifting trends: Trends can impact your pricing
- Campaign management prices: The price you pay for campaign management can impact your pricing.
